Jio GigaFiber effect: BSNL's Rs. 699 broadband plan now offers 700GB data at 20Mbps speed

BSNL's Rs. 699 broadband plan has been revised to offer double the data and speed in wake of Jio GigaFiber launch in India. Here are more details on BSNL BBG Combo ULD 699 broadband plan.
BSNL's Rs. 699 broadband plan revised to take on Jio GigaFiber Bharat Sanchar Nigam Limited (BSNL) is one of the leading broadband service providers in India, however, in wake of the Jio GigaFiber launch in India, BSNL has revised its one of the most popular broadband plan to offer double the data and at higher speeds. BSNL’s Rs. 699 broadband plan has been revised in order to counter Jio GigaFiber FTTH broadband services.

The plan is also known as the BSNL BBG Combo ULD 699 broadband plan and it now offers 700GB of high-speed data which is double than before along with speeds of up to 20Mbps. Moreover, since it is an unlimited plan, users will be able to enjoy internet access at 2Mbps even after the FUP limit gets exhausted. Earlier, BSNL's Rs. 699 broadband plan used to offer broadband speeds of 10 Mbps.
The revision has been made in Chennai circle only since it is only available in that particular circle. On the other hand, BSNL is offering broadband plans such as Rs 695, Rs 799 and more for other circles. BSNL's Rs. 699 broadband plan is part of the fixed-line voice calling service as well and it comes bundled with unlimited voice calls within India to any network.

Meanwhile, Reliance Jio is gearing up for the Jio GigaFiber rollout and according to a recent report, the company will launch the Jio GigaFiber Preview Offer, through which, users will be able to avail 100GB of free data per month for the first three months with broadband speeds of up to 100Mbps.
